What is NOT considered a component of the typical starting system?

Starter motor

Battery

Voltage regulator

The correct answer is identified as the voltage regulator because it is not a direct component of the typical starting system. The starting system's primary function is to initiate the engine's operation, and its core components include the battery, starter motor, and ignition switch.

The battery provides the necessary electrical energy to start the engine, while the starter motor functions to crank the engine when activated. The ignition switch serves to complete the circuit and engage the starter motor when the driver turns the key to the "start" position.

In contrast, the voltage regulator is primarily part of the charging system. Its role is to maintain the appropriate voltage level in the electrical system while the engine is running, ensuring the battery is charged correctly. It does not perform any function related to the starting of the engine itself, making it the element that does not belong to the starting system's components.
